Now you’ve likely encountered multiple options when it comes to configuring your Teams Rooms account. Here’s the burning question: which command do you use to pave the way for seamless meeting acceptance and eliminate conflicts?

A. Set-CalendarProcessing -AllowConflicts $true
B. Set-CalendarProcessing -AutomateProcessing AutoUpdate
C. Set-CalendarProcessing -AutomateProcessing AutoAccept
D. Set-CalendarProcessing -Identity Room1 -AllowConflicts $false

If you chose C, bravo! You’ve uncovered the golden key: Set-CalendarProcessing -AutomateProcessing AutoAccept. This command magically allows the Microsoft Teams Rooms account to automatically accept meeting requests. No more waiting around for approvals, and it actively manages the schedule without needing your constant attention.

You know what really makes this command shine? It doesn’t just automate approval; it also stops any double bookings in their tracks. The system is smart enough to reject further requests that might clash with already accepted meetings, thus optimizing the room's usage and keeping your scheduling process slick and efficient.
